Welcome to Siftgate's validator plugin system! Each validator is just a class implementing `check()` and `describe()`, dropped into the plugins directory and auto-discovered at boot. Don't be clever with shared state — plugins must be stateless or you'll chase heisenbugs for days (ask anyone who touched the dedupe validator). Registration order matters for short-circuiting, which trips everyone up at least once. The full plugin authoring guide, with examples and gotchas, lives on the internal page below.

dashboard of tawef-hagug = https://superset.norvadyn.local/display/projects/build/ticket/build/spaces/ticket/1e989f0e6c200d20fc4ae06b

Ticket: Staging env misconfigured for Siftgate bloom filter

The bloom layer in front of the Pellet KV store is rejecting all lookups in staging because the env file was copied from the dev template without credentials. False-positive tuning values are fine; only the auth line is missing. To unblock the weekly demo, the Pellet admission secret must be set on the following line.

env line for yaguf-fajop: LEDGER_TOKEN13=fb08984397349

## Deploying the Gatewick Proctor Queue

Deploys are pretty painless: push to main, wait for the pipeline, then watch the queue drain dashboard for five minutes. If candidates pile up mid-exam, roll back first and ask questions later — the queue replays safely. Everything the workers care about lives in one config block, shown here for reference.

settings of bafof-yagef:
JOROX_PIN=8740
JOROX_TENANT=pelox
JOROX_METRICS_HOST=metrics.jorox.qorvelworks.internal
JOROX_SEAL=seal_c78f63c1
JOROX_STANDBY_TEAM=norax

Ticket DV-housekeeping 228: The Larchview diff viewer fails on files over 50 MB in the prevetting environment. Root cause is a misconfigured environment, not the chunking logic: the service was deployed without the blob-store credential, so large diffs fall back to in-memory rendering and time out. Flagging for security review because the workaround someone applied was to disable auth on the blob proxy entirely, which must be reverted. The correct fix is to restore the credential in the env file as shown here.

vault entry, yahif-yajep: COURIER_KEY29=b802bdf8034096b65a51c6ba5abe2